At this as the title of an article, a montage of Eisenstein and classification methodology, based on different relationships and different levels from simple to complex is divided into five categories:

Metrical montage: purely in accordance with the precise length of time editing the lens, which is one of the most easy way to handle this is just a passing Eisenstein;

Rhythm of montage: the former is more advanced, it is not easy in the time interval as the standard, but consider the audience to experience the length of time, such as a close-up lens and a panoramic camera and so long gives the feeling on the length of time that is not the same as of; Eisenstein consider the rhythm of the clip should be the actual feeling of the people for the criteria for the classification, rather than in accordance with a stopwatch to calculate the abstract;

Rhythmic montage: more complex, in addition to the original tempo has increased (or replaced, this author did not explicitly) the nature of another kind, but also with music terminology analogy: continuous lens (Eisenstein called Movie the "fragment") at a clip after "emotional quality", these lenses have a unity, are presented in the same mood, with a "mood";

Tune montage: the same style are refined. Eisenstein continue to use music to describe, a very complex way of editing, need to consider the mobilization of all the emotional factors, even the most minimal visual details. This is like our music section of the feeling not only from its tempo and rhythm, there are hardly aware of but for the color contrast of the "overtone" and "chord."

Rational Montage: This is a way to harmonize the transfer from the emotional to the rational line, a combination of the above-mentioned construction of the way, considering all levels of a number of conditions: the length of time, rhythm, emotional delivery, tone and color details, as long as it is a variety of subtle meaning.

Functional and non-functional requirements 区别~ 请用英文回答

Functional requirements: These are statements of services the system should provide, how the system should react to particular inputs and how the system should behave in particular situations. In some case, the functional requirements may also explicitly state what the system should not do. Functional requirements set out services the system should provide. Describe functionality or system services. Depend on the type of software, expected users and the type of system where the software is used. Functional user requirements may be high-level statements of what the system should do but functional system requirements should describe the system services in detail. Non-functional requirements: These are constraints on the services or functions offered by the system. They include timing constraints, constraints on the developments process and standards. Non-functional requirements often apply to the system as a whole. They do not usually just apply to indivisual system features or services. Non-functional requirements constrain the system being developed or the development process. These define system properties and constraints e.g. reliability, response time and storage requirements. Constraints are I/O device capability, system representations, etc. Non-functional requirements may be more critical than functional requirements. If these are not met, the system is useless.

Try It Out—Static Libraries Let"s create our own small library containing two functions and then use one of them in an example pro- gram. The functions are called fred and bill and just print greetings. 1. First, we"ll create separate source files (imaginatively called fred.c and bill.c) for each of them. Here"s the first: #include <stdio.h> void fred(int arg) { printf(“fred: you passed %d ”, arg); }10 Getting Started And here"s the second: #include <stdio.h> void bill(char *arg) { printf(“bill: you passed %s ”, arg); }2. We can compile these functions individually to produce object files ready for inclusion into a library. We do this by invoking the C compiler with the -c option, which prevents the compiler from trying to create a complete program. Trying to create a complete program would fail because we haven"t defined a function called main. $ gcc -c bill.c fred.c $ ls *.o bill.o fred.o3. Now let"s write a program that calls the function bill. First, it"s a good idea to create a header file for our library. This will declare the functions in our library and should be included by all applications that wish to use our library. It"s a good idea to include the header file in the files fred.c and bill.c too. This will help the compiler pick up any errors. /* This is lib.h. It declares the functions fred and bill for users */ void bill(char *); void fred(int);4. The calling program (program.c) can be very simple. It includes the library header file and calls one of the functions from the library. #include “lib.h” int main() { bill(“Hello World”); exit(0); }5. We can now compile the program and test it. For now, we"ll specify the object files explicitly to the compiler, asking it to compile our file and link it with the previously compiled object mod- ule bill.o. $ cgcc -c program.c $ cgcc -o program program.o bill.o $ ./program bill: we passed Hello World $6. Now let"s create and use a library. We use the ar program to create the archive and add our object files to it. The program is called ar because it creates archives, or collections, of individual 11Chapter 1 files placed together in one large file. Note that we can also use ar to create archives of files of any type. (Like many UNIX utilities, ar is a generic tool.) $ ar crv libfoo.a bill.o fred.o a - bill.o a - fred.o 7. The library is created and the two object files added. To use the library successfully, some sys- tems, notably those derived from Berkeley UNIX, require that a table of contents be created for the library. We do this with the ranlib command. In Linux, this step isn"t necessary (but it is harmless) when we"re using the GNU software development tools. $ ranlib libfoo.a Our library is now ready to use. We can add to the list of files to be used by the compiler to create our program like this: $ gcc -o program program.o libfoo.a $ ./program bill: you passed Hello World $ We could also use the –l option to access our library, but as it is not in any of the standard places, we have to tell the compiler where to find it by using the –L option like this: $ gcc –o program program.o –L. –lfoo The –L. option tells the compiler to look in the current directory (.) for libraries. The –lfoo option tells the compiler to use a library called libfoo.a (or a shared library, libfoo.so, if one is present). To see which functions are included in an object file, library, or executable program, we can use the nm command. If we take a look at program and lib.a, we see that the library contains both fred and bill, but that program contains only bill. When the program is created, it includes only functions from the library that it actually needs. Including the header file, which contains declarations for all of the func- tions in the library, doesn"t cause the entire library to be included in the final program. If we"re familiar with Windows software development, there are a number of direct analogies here: Item UNIX Windows object module func.o FUNC.OBJ static library lib.a LIB.LIB program program PROGRAM.EXE
